Freshman satisfaction reaches record high
A survey of freshmen shows that more of them than ever before are very pleased with their decision to attend Rose-Hulman.
Each year, the students affairs office polls freshmen for responses about all aspects of student life.
This year’s poll results showed that 87 percent of freshmen were extremely pleased or pleased with their decision to attend Rose-Hulman. A survey record, 49 percent, said they were extremely pleased with their college choice.
Freshmen indicated the most positive aspects of Rose-Hulman were: friendly and qualified faculty and staff, personalized attention, and an outstanding academic environment. The most common negative aspect cited by new students was the academic workload and resulting stress.
